How can I determine if a PDF is Fillable/Interactive?
When I call SecurityInfo with the parameter set to 7, Form Field Fill-in or Signing, it returns a 6 for forms whose text cannot be changed and appear in Acrobat Reader without the message "This file includes Fillable Form Fields." It even returns 6 for image only PDFs. What method in QuickPDF Library can I use to get the property of the PDF is Acrobat Reader using to know whether or not to display the "This file includes Fillable Form Fields."? Thanks, Tom

Hi Tom,
you can use function FormFieldCount. It returns the total number of formfields in a selected document. So if the returning value is higher than 0 you know that the document is interactive with fillable formfields.
